City Manager

The City Manager is responsible for the day-to-day operation of the City. The City Manager is ably assisted by a team of professional public administrators and is appointed by a five-member City Commission in a traditional Commission-Manager form of government.

Alfred Jerome Fletcher II, who goes by Jerome, became North Port City Manager on Oct. 1, 2021. He has more than 20 years of experience as a public servant and leader. Mr. Fletcher received the Credentialed Manager designation from the International City/County management Association (ICMA) in April 2022. He is also a member of the Florida City/County Managers Association (FCCMA) and serves on the FCCMA Fiscal and Administrative Policy Committee. He has earned a Bachelor of Science in Accounting and a master’s degree in Public Administration. Mr. Fletcher has been married for 20 wonderful years with two amazing young children.

Since coming to North Port, Mr. Fletcher has worked to establish a "Community of Unity" by engaging with citizens through "Meet and Mingle" information and Q&A sessions and other opportunities for interaction with residents. In 2022, he instituted a newly streamlined budgeting process that includes greater public feedback, incorporates the City Commission's Strategic Plan and Strategic Pillars and improves transparency and accountability through online performance data tracking. Also in 2022, he helped guide the City's Hurricane Ian response and long-term recovery efforts from this devastating, near-Category 5 storm.

Mr. Fletcher came to North Port from the DC Metro Area, where he previously served as an Assistant Chief Administrative Officer for Montgomery County, Maryland. This local government is a suburb of our nation’s capital, has more than one million people in population and its economic development is built on being ranked as the #4 leader in life sciences in the country. In this position, he led daily operations and important decision-making processes as a member of the County Executive’s leadership team and his portfolio contained economic development, housing and community affairs, workforce development, and transportation.

Mr. Fletcher has an extensive history working in economic development, which drives him to implement a strong business advancement strategy, including expanding revenue sources and fiscally prudent management. He is always looking to strike the proper balance with attracting and retaining new businesses as well as making sure the backbone of our economy, small businesses, have a seat at the table as well.

Jason Yarborough joined the City in 2018 after over 20 years of municipal government experience. He most recently served as City Administrator for the City of Lake Helen, Fla. Prior to that, he served as Utilities Director in Palm Bay, Fla. He holds a Master’s degree in Public Administration from the University of West Florida, and a bachelor’s degree from Loyola University in New Orleans.

In his position, Jason oversees the Public Works, Utilities, and Development Services departments.

Julie has been with the City for over 40 years and most recently served as the Public Works Director before stepping up to fill the Acting Assistant City Manager role for Jason. She has been overseeing the Public Works, Utilities, and Neighborhood Development Services Departments as well as Acting Director of Neighborhood Development Services since coming to the City Manager’s Office. Her depth of historical and institutional knowledge on the City and operations of various departments over the years is an invaluable resource and serves the team well with interdepartmental collaborations.
